Copyright Office Proposes Amending Regulations to Address Disruption of Copyright Office Electronic Systems
Issue No. 656 - March 2, 2017


The U.S. Copyright Office is proposing to amend its regulations to address the effect of a disruption or suspension of any Office electronic system on the Office’s receipt of applications, fees, deposits, or other materials. The amended regulations specify how the Office will assign effective dates of receipt to materials attempted to be submitted during a disruption or suspension of an Office electronic system. In addition, the proposed rule specifies how the Office will assign effective dates of receipt when a specific submission is lost in the absence of a declaration of disruption, as might occur during the security screening procedures used for mail that is delivered to the Office.

The Office seeks public comments on the proposed regulations that will be considered in promulgating a final rule.

The proposed regulations and instructions on how to submit a comment are available on the Regulations to Address the Disruption of Copyright Office Electronic Systems webpage. Written comments must be received no later than April 3, 2017, at 11:59 p.m. Eastern time.
